Greetings,

This is a silly question, but.

Between NASDAQ Composite Index and E-mini S&P 500 Futures, who would be more leading?

In a smaller time-frame (3 to 10 minutes) who would respect, R/S, MAs, candlesticks , etc, more?

Thank you.

Joseph689 View Post
Between NASDAQ Composite Index and E-mini S&P 500 Futures, who would be more leading?

If your question had a definitive answer, risk-free arbitrage would be possible and the market would not function.

In other words, it depends. They are each a basket of stocks, and it depends on the basket and on how arbitrageurs operate at any given time.

Today NQ (not COMP as I do not watch the cash) was quite a bit stronger and was making new highs before ES did its stop run. In this case, NQ led. later in the day it made another run while ES did not budge. It "led" but the ES did not follow.

So, again, it depends.
